Official abstract text for this publication.
A cover device ( 2 ) for a drink container comprises a basic assembly ( 9 ) which is provided with a drink opening ( 32 ), and a valve arrangement ( 20 ) for blocking or unblocking a passage to the drink opening ( 32 ) from a drink container side of the cover device ( 2 ). The valve arrangement ( 20 ) comprises a valve element ( 26 ) having two portions ( 27, 28 ) which are connected to each other through an area of the valve element ( 26 ) at a position where the valve element ( 26 ) is hingably associated with the basic assembly ( 9 ), and wherein only one of the two portions ( 27, 28 ) is in direct communication with the drink opening ( 32 ) of the basic assembly ( 9 ), so that a smallest total moment of force may be realized on the one portion ( 28 ) when the valve element ( 26 ) is subjected to pressure from the drink container side of the cover device ( 2 ).

The invention claimed is: 1. A cover device for a drink container, the cover device comprising: a basic assembly that includes a housing with a spout portion, the housing having a locally supporting hinge contact surface portion, and the spout portion having a drink opening; and a valve arrangement that comprises a valve element having first and second portions which are integral with each other through an area of the valve element that corresponds with a position of the locally supporting hinge contact surface portion in response to the valve element being hingably associated with the basic assembly at the locally supporting hinge contact surface portion, wherein only the first portion of the valve element is configured for being directly influenced, via a passage to the drink opening, to block or unblock the passage to the drink opening, wherein the second portion of the valve element is not configured for being directly influenced, via the passage to the drink opening, to block or unblock the passage to the drink opening, and wherein the first and second portions of the valve element are configured in size, position, and orientation for (i) assuming a leakproof closed state that includes the valve element having a smaller total moment of force on the first portion of the valve element than on the second portion of the valve element in response to the valve element being subjected to an overpressure prevailing at a side of the cover device adapted to face the drink container, and (ii) assuming an open state in response to the valve element being subjected to an underpressure prevailing from a side of the cover device having the drink opening. 2. The cover device according to claim 1 , wherein the first portion of the valve element is smaller than the second portion of the valve element. 3. The cover device according to claim 1 , wherein the first portion of the valve element comprises a projecting edge portion for contacting a surface portion of the basic assembly, wherein the valve arrangement assumes the closed state in response to the projecting edge portion making contact with the surface portion of the basic assembly, and wherein the valve arrangement assumes the open state in response to the projecting edge portion being separated at a distance from the surface portion of the basic assembly. 4. The cover device according to claim 1 , wherein the valve element comprises flexible material. 5. The cover device according to claim 1 , wherein the first portion of the valve element comprises a ring-shaped portion at a side of an inner periphery of the valve element, and wherein the second portion of the valve element comprises a ring-shaped portion at a side of an outer periphery of the valve element. 6. An assembly of a drink container and the cover device according to claim 1 , wherein the cover device is removably attached to the drink container.
